The movie tells the story of how ETA (spanish terrorist team that exist noawdays yet) prepared their first terrorist attack, they killed Luis Carrero Blanco, the Prime Minister of Spain in that moment, there was a dictatorship and the dictator was Franco, well the thing is that ETA wanted to kill the Prime Minister and they did it, they learned the route he used to do everyday, so they made a hole in a room of a building that was at the same level as the road and they put explosives underneath the pavement, when the car drove over it they activated the explosives launching the car in the air and causing it to go over a building to then end up in an interior courtyard of that building, unbelievable yes! but it happened and so you can see it in the screenshots ive taken, as you can see in the movie they did it with a model of the street "Claudio Coello" (very famous for spanish people because of what it happened in it) and model cars, this happened on December the 23rd of 1973, it was ETA´s first attack... if you want to know about more about this go to http://clientes.vianetworks.es/personal/angelberto/CarrBlanco.htm , you have to know spanish to read it, althought you dont know spanish if you want to know how it happened go to that web and watch the drawing of the "jump" the car did. The (Spanish) Dart was the predecessor of this car and in essence a copy of the 1963-65 US Dodge Dart, built in Spain after production had ceased in the US. The 3700 GT replaced it in 1969 and though being based on the Dart, was developed and designed in Spain and has no US counterpart. -- Last edit: 2006-11-10 15:52:19 |

On a 1977 Italian magazine article are visible trials of car jump scene into movie and in one photo was visible a man when put the Dodge model car over an explosive charge pack and in another--tragically grotesque--of another man that sweeps and clean the scaled-down road diorama passing thru 1:18 Seats,Renaults,Citroens,etc.,like a giant!!!... The former title,as article says,was"Comando Txikia"and the former director should be a certain Josè Luis Madrid,then changed in "Ogro",when the movie was given into hands of great Italian movie director Gillo Pontecorvo(awarded in 1966 at Venice Movie Festival with "Golden Lion"award for the movie titled"La battaglia di Algeri/The Battle of Alger" and died that year,unhappy) |

When in 1969 Chrysler Europe took the control on Barreiros Diesel S.A., the company was renamed Chrysler España S.A. Chryseler received all the properties and actives of Barreiros Diesel S.A., including Villaverde's factory (Nowadays a PSA factory where 207's and C3 are built). So From 1970 to 1979, when all Chrysler cars were renamed Talbot, the cars were built by Chrysler España. |
